The study of the interaction between humans and the equipment they use is called Human Factors or Ergonomics. This field focuses on understanding how people interact with various tools and systems to improve efficiency, safety, and user experience. It encompasses disciplines such as psychology, engineering, and design to optimize product usability and enhance overall performance.

Something made by humans is called an "artifact." Artifacts can range from tools and clothing to structures and artworks, reflecting the culture, technology, and values of the society that created them. They are often studied in fields like archaeology and anthropology to gain insights into human history and development.

The interaction between humans and the environment is commonly referred to as "human-environment interaction" or "human-environment interaction dynamics." This concept explores how human activities, such as agriculture, urbanization, and industrialization, impact natural ecosystems, and conversely, how environmental factors influence human behavior and societal development. It encompasses issues like resource use, environmental degradation, and sustainability efforts. Understanding this interaction is crucial for addressing environmental challenges and promoting sustainable practices.

Anthrozoologists study the interaction and relationship between humans and animals, including the psychological, social, and physical benefits of this interaction. They may also focus on animal behavior, welfare, and the impact of human-animal interactions on both parties.
